Transaction 2c28895097f52cff6237bdbb23008333fde097a6afa84e256ce0b27ce19021de
1 Input
1 Output
-
2c28895097f52cff6237bdbb23008333fde097a6afa84e256ce0b27ce19021de:0
- value
- 278584
- script pubkey
- OP_0 OP_PUSHBYTES_20 107a61bf34bbb7cd4cc91d11a29c33647547c806
- address
- bc1qzpaxr0e5hwmu6nxfr5g698pnv3650jqx8kc7df